Peak Season Highlights
Summer (June to August)
During the summer months, this destination experiences its busiest season, attracting visitors seeking warm weather and extended daylight hours. It's an ideal time to enjoy outdoor activities and explore the scenic surroundings.
Winter (December to February)
In winter, the area becomes a hub for snow sports enthusiasts and those eager to experience snowy landscapes. The cold temperatures and festive atmosphere draw many travelers to this region at this time.
Off-Season Highlights
Shoulder Season (April to May)
Springtime offers fewer crowds and milder weather, making it a peaceful period to visit without the peak season hustle. It's a great opportunity to enjoy the area's natural beauty in a quieter setting.
Fall (September to November)
Autumn brings cooler temperatures and stunning fall foliage, providing a tranquil escape with less tourism activity. This season is perfect for experiencing the region’s natural serenity before the winter rush begins.

Family Activities
- Reindeer Discovery Center Explore this engaging attraction to learn about Alaskan wildlife and enjoy interactive experiences suitable for the whole family.
- Iditarod Trail Sled Dog Race Museum Discover the history of this legendary race through exhibits and artifacts that excite both kids and adults alike.
- Wasilla Lake Park Spend quality time outdoors at this scenic park with opportunities for picnicking, fishing, and lakeside walks in a peaceful setting.
- Lazy Mountain Loop Trail Embark on a family-friendly hike along this trail that offers breathtaking views of the surrounding region without a strenuous climb.
